1. How many bugs are in the fix queue now, and with what priority?

2. Will crosshair during aiming ever be removed? I realise it's obviously not the highest priority feature, but it's really needed.

3. On the dev stream I noticed some pretty strong ghosting. Is this FSR 3 Native AA, FSR 3 or did you make the changes in TAA?

4. Which version of Unity 2022 will 1.0 use?

5. What are you working on now?
1.  3 10 86 18 1 = 118. From highest to lowest priority. As usual, not all of those will addressed for experimental or even stable and more will get added.

2.  I don't know. Most of us are not gun purists and probably don't even look at the iron sights. I put the + on the target and shoot. I do realize it annoys some people and could be better.

3.  It is FSR. It adds some ghosting on certain types of motion. It will probably not change for 1.0 and the older AA methods are available for those who don't like it.

4.  Currently 2022.3.29, but could get a bump if we need another bug fix.

5.  Falling tree improvements for old ugly I noticed yesterday.

As I understand it, the issue is that when the rear frame of the gun is raised too high, then obscuring part of the target or too much of the field of view is exactly what the problem is. The best examples are probably the pump shotgun, auto-shotgun, and tac rifle, all of which take up a fair amount of the screen when aimed. The last two also have kind of weird sights - the auto-shotty has that shallow-fat front sight, and the tac rifle has a narrow triple leaf design that crowds the target.

For me, it's not a huge deal, especially since shotguns aren't exactly useful for sniping, but I get what they're saying.

This has been a thing in No Man's Sky for years, especially when flying fast with the ship at low altitude, which has been greatly improved over the years, that game uses a fade shader. 

For reference, even today there is a mod to disable it in NMS and it IMPROVES performance slightly depending on the situation, while this mod years ago improved performance a lot due to the lack of optimization in that shader. Anyway the mod is not worth it unless you have very bad fps, as it worsens the pop-in feeling quite a lot and also doesn't improve the draw distance.
